thurl

thurl is defined in Webster's Unabridged Dictionary (1913) with 3 senses. The full text of each entry is reproduced verbatim below.

Definitions

  1. 1.(Mining) (a) A short communication between adits in a mine. (b) A long adit in a coalpit.
  2. 2.To cut through; to pierce. [Obs.] Piers Plowman.
  3. 3.(Mining) To cut through, as a partition between one working and another.
